Essential Functions:
- Partner with senior scientists to develop chromatographic in support of dose formulation testing
- Complete tasks necessary for daily operation in the laboratory: execute analytical tests to ensure the accuracy, homogeneity and precision to support on-site compounding by the Celerion Pharmacy team.
- Preparation of standard calibrators, quality controls, mobile phases, and solutions for the purpose of testing dose formulations.
- Inventory and re-order parts when used for instrument maintenance and repair
- Assist in troubleshooting instrumentation aspects of studies
- Take part in instrumentation upkeep by observing the maintenance schedule and performing calibrations and preventative maintenance
- Communicate results effectively and in a timely manner to other associates
- Initiate, introduce, and implement new guidelines and procedures through the development of working instructions
- Optimize instruments to support ruggedness testing, production flexibility, and production
- Prepare documentation to share method development results with the sponsor
- Write detailed methodologies and provide feedback on Dose Formulation Protocols.
Requirements:
- Bachelor's degree in Chemistry, Biochemistry, or related scientific field
- 3-5 years of hands-on experience with analytical instrumentation and/or method development (highly preferred)
- Self-directed, self-motivated, and detail-oriented
- Strong desire to learn new techniques with openness to cross-training opportunities
- Flexibility to work outside normal business hours as needed to meet testing timelines, including occasional long days, evenings and weekends
